Identify Access Things
To properly rodent-proof your outside space, begin by determining prospective entry points. Evaluate your backyard for any type of spaces or openings that rodents could use to access. Examine areas such as spaces under doors, holes in the walls, or openings around utility infiltrations. Remember that mice can press via openings as small as a dime, so be thorough in your exam.
Concentrate on areas where utilities enter your home, such as where pipelines, cable televisions, or cords get in the structure. Seal any gaps around these entrance factors with products like steel wool or caulk. In addition, look for any kind of fractures in the foundation or voids in the siding that could act as access points for rats.
Pay very close attention to locations where plants meets your home, as overgrown plants can supply concealing spots and easy gain access to for rodents. Trim back any type of overhanging branches or bushes that could be utilized as bridges to your home. By identifying and sealing off these entry points, you can substantially minimize the possibilities of rats attacking your outside room.
Implement Exemption Steps
Evaluating and sealing access points is the first step in rodent-proofing your outdoor space; currently you'll take action by applying exemption actions.
Start by mounting door brushes up on all outside doors to stop rats from squeezing via gaps. Seal splits and gaps with weather-resistant sealant, focusing on areas where energy pipelines enter your home.
Use cord mesh to cover vents and smokeshafts, ensuring they're securely affixed. Trim tree branches and plants far from the house to get rid of prospective bridges for rodents to access your roof.
Furthermore, consider mounting steel flashing around the base of your home to avoid burrowing. Shop fire wood a minimum of 18 inches off the ground and far from your home.
Maintain garbage in tightly secured containers, and promptly tidy up any splashed birdseed or pet food. By implementing these exemption measures, you can substantially minimize the possibility of rats attacking your outside room.
Maintain Tidiness and Trimmed Landscaping
Ensure your outdoor area stays neat and your landscape design is on a regular basis trimmed to deter rodents from locating harborage or food sources. Keeping your lawn clean is vital to decreasing attractions for rodents. Get rid of any kind of debris, clutter, or extra products that could serve as concealing places for these bugs. Rats are drawn to areas with very easy access to food and sanctuary, so by keeping tidiness, you make your residential or commercial property less appealing to them.
Regularly trimming your landscape design is likewise essential in rodent-proofing your outdoor space. Overgrown greenery offers rodents with adequate hiding areas and possible nesting websites. By maintaining your yard trimmed, bushes trimmed, and trees trimmed, you eliminate possible habitats for rats. Furthermore, trimmed landscape design makes it harder for rats to access your home as they favor areas with enough coverage for security.
